Bob Nystrom 85750ca338 feat: add StringCodePointSequence class and expose codePoints property on String
Extract codePointAt() logic into a dedicated StringCodePointSequence class that wraps a string and implements the Sequence interface, enabling iteration over code points. Add a `codePoints` getter to String that returns a new instance of this sequence. Refactor the underlying C implementation of `codePointAt_` to decode UTF-8 into actual code point integers (returning raw bytes for invalid sequences) and rename the primitive to use trailing underscore convention. Update all related tests to reflect the new behavior where mid-sequence byte indices return the raw byte string instead of an empty string, and add new test files for the code point sequence iteration.

This contains the automated validation suite for the VM and built-in libraries.

  • benchmark/ - Performance tests. These aren't strictly pass/fail, but let us compare performance both against other languages and against previous builds of Wren itself.

  • core/ - Tests for the built in core library, mainly methods on the core classes. If a bug is in wren_core.c or wren_value.c, it will most likely break one of these tests.

  • io/ - Tests for the built in IO library. In other words, methods on the IO class. If a bug is in wren_io.c, it should break one of these tests.

  • language/ - Tests of the language itself, its grammar and runtime semantics. If a bug is in wren_compiler.c or wren_vm.c, it will most likely break one of these tests. This includes tests for the syntax for the literal forms of the core classes.

  • limit/ - Tests for various hardcoded limits. The language doesn't officially specify these limits, but the Wren implementation has them. These tests ensure that limit behavior is well-defined and tested.
